Just for further explaination about our system.

If you make above what they consider poverty level, which is about $30,000.00 per year for a family, total medical coverage for your family is $96.00 per month. If your income is less than that medical coverage is free. I don't pay anything for my medical coverage.

We have to pay for prescriptions, but again, if your income is low you don't pay anything. And, everyone has a limit and after that medication is covered. A lot of people purchase extended medical coverage that pays for all medication, dental, etc. This additional coverage also pays for things like power wheelchairs, etc.

I did not have extended medical so the ALS Society provided these items. We also have other sources for equipment, I got my ventilators, suction machines and supplies from them at no cost.

No system is perfect but we don't have to worry about going bankrupt with medical bills.
